A rapidly growing deadly fungus, thought to have emerged in humans due to climate change, is one of the targets of a £17.9 million drug project.
Candida auris is a type of yeast that can cause severe illness and spreads easily among patients in healthcare facilities. It was first seen in Japan in 2009 and has spread worldwide, with outbreaks in hospitals in the UK, South Africa, India and parts of North and South America.
These are points from the rest of a must-read article.
- The first cases in the UK were recorded in 2014 and numbers have been rising yearly since 2020.
- Found particularly in hospitals and care homes.
- Many infections occur when medical devices such as catheters or ventilators are fitted to patients.

Research From The University Of Padua
This paper on the US National Library of Medicine, which is from the University of Padua in Italy.
The University followed a group of 138 patients with coeliac disease, who had been on a gluten-free diet for at least six years, through the first wave of the Covid-19 pandemic in Padua.
This sentence, sums up the study.
In this analysis we report a real life “snapshot” of a cohort of CeD patients during the SARS-CoV-2 outbreak in Italy, all followed in one tertiary centre in a red area of Northern Italy. Our data show, in accordance with Emmi et al., the absolute absence of COVID-19 diagnosis in our population, although 18 subjects experienced flu-like symptoms with only one having undergone naso-pharyngeal swab.
It says that no test subject caught Covid-19, in an admittedly smallish number of patients.

I found this paper on Cureus, which is entitled Celiac Disease and Risk of Atrial Fibrillation: A Meta-Analysis and Systematic Review.
I will show two paragraphs from the Abstract,
This is the Introduction.
Several studies have found celiac disease may be associated with a variety of cardiac manifestations. Atrial fibrillation (AF) is one of the most common arrhythmias that can cause significant morbidity. However, the risk of atrial fibrillation in patients with celiac disease according to epidemiological studies remains unclear. The aim of this meta-analysis study is to assess the risk of atrial fibrillation in patients diagnosed with celiac disease compared to controls.
And this is the Conclusion.
A significant association between celiac disease and risk of atrial fibrillation was reported in this study. There is a 38% increased risk of atrial fibrillation. Additional studies are needed to clarify the mechanistic link between atrial fibrillation and celiac disease. Some of the limitations of this study are that all were observational studies, some were medical registry-based and there was high heterogeneity between studies.
